Hugh Edmonson Caldwell 1803–1891 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Abt 1803

Birth Location: Montgomery County, Virginia

Death Date: 1 Oct 1891

Death Location: Montgomery County, Virginia

Father: Stephen Caldwell

Mother: Margaret Weir

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1803, Hugh Edmonson Caldwell entered the world in Montgomery County, Virginia, born to Stephen Caldwell And Margaret Elizabeth Weir. Hugh Edmonson Caldwell passed away in 1891 in Montgomery County, Virginia.
